Code GenieCodeGenie
The Essential Guide to API Services for Developers and Businesses

Home > Blog > The Essential Guide to API Services for Developers and Businesses


The Essential Guide to API Services for Developers and Businesses



Ellipse  Sara, Published on: 2024-04-26 20:05:34.022000



The Essential Guide to API services for Developers and Businesses

Are you curious about how API services can transform your digital projects or business operations? Wondering how APIs can enhance your B2B or B2C offerings? Or perhaps you're seeking insights into the best practices for integrating API services effectively? This guide dives deep into the world of API services, outlining their significance, the benefits they bring to developers and businesses, and the key considerations for successful implementation.

Understanding API Services


APIs, or Application Programming Interfaces, are the cornerstone of modern software development, enabling disparate systems to communicate and share data seamlessly. At its core, an API acts as a messenger that allows developers to query and retrieve functionality from an external software component or service. This is especially crucial in today's interconnected digital ecosystem, where the ability to integrate and leverage external services can significantly enhance the functionality and value of software applications. For businesses, API services offer a pathway to innovate, by embedding or offering sophisticated features without the need to develop those capabilities in-house.

The Role of API Services in Digital Transformation


API services are pivotal in driving digital transformation across various industries, serving as the building blocks that empower developers to create complex, feature-rich applications efficiently. In the B2B sector, APIs facilitate seamless integration between different business systems, enabling companies to streamline operations, enhance data exchange, and improve customer experiences. For B2C applications, APIs allow businesses to rapidly deploy consumer-facing functionalities, from payment processing and social media integration to geolocation services and beyond. The utility of API services in both spheres underscores their versatility and critical role in the tech landscape.

Navigating the World of API Services


To effectively leverage API services, developers and businesses must navigate considerations such as scalability, reliability, and security. Scalability ensures that API services can handle varying levels of demand, a crucial factor for applications that experience fluctuating usage patterns. Reliability, measured in uptime and response times, guarantees that services remain accessible and performant. Security is paramount, as APIs often access sensitive data and must be protected against unauthorized access and breaches. Additionally, compliance with industry standards and regulations is essential, especially for APIs dealing with financial transactions, healthcare data, or other sensitive information.

Benefits of API Services


The integration of API services offers significant advantages, including accelerated development timelines, enhanced application functionality, and the ability to focus on core business strategies rather than the nuances of specific technologies. For developers, APIs provide the tools needed to build complex solutions quickly, leveraging existing services and data. This modularity and reusability of code not only speed up the development process but also reduce costs. For businesses, APIs open up new revenue streams and partnership opportunities, enabling them to offer their services in a more scalable and flexible manner. Through APIs, companies can extend their market reach, adapt to changing market conditions more swiftly, and deliver superior customer experiences.


Conclusion


API services are indispensable in the digital age, serving as the glue that connects various technologies and platforms. Whether you're a developer looking to enhance your applications or a business aiming to drive digital innovation, understanding and effectively integrating API services is key. By focusing on scalability, reliability, security, and compliance, and by leveraging the benefits APIs offer, you can unlock new opportunities and achieve greater success in your digital endeavors.


More like this...

How API Limits Shape Your Business Strategy

In a world where data is king, managing your monthly API calls is crucial for maintaining efficiency and cost-effectiveness. This article delves into the implications of API call limits, offering a comprehensive guide on how businesses can optimize their usage to avoid service disruptions. Through strategic planning and understanding tiered plans, companies can ensure they're getting the most out of their API services, aligning their operational needs with their budgetary constraints. ++++++++++++++++++++

The Unsung Heroes: Developer Tools and Documentation in API Integration

The success of any API service heavily relies on the accessibility and quality of its developer tools and documentation. This piece highlights the importance of well-crafted documentation and robust developer tools in the API ecosystem. By providing clear, concise, and comprehensive resources, businesses can significantly ease the integration process for developers, leading to faster deployment times and a smoother user experience. ++++++++++++++++++++

Ensuring API Scalability and Reliability: What You Need to Know

As businesses grow, so does the demand on their digital services. This article explores the critical aspects of API scalability and reliability, essential for supporting the dynamic needs of modern applications. Readers will learn about the challenges of scaling API calls, the importance of uptime, and strategies to ensure consistent performance, even under the heaviest loads. ++++++++++++++++++++